Output 065152bf95ab80b7a6f233281b5f933c6f898f09f3c9119594c70964a829ae4f:2

value
78696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ba1556120e9cef92ad1e69ca3058bdfbd951e4b2 OP_EQUAL
address
3JewAgzN4KhjYr9Rd28gpkV2AhYsfYxi2U
transaction
065152bf95ab80b7a6f233281b5f933c6f898f09f3c9119594c70964a829ae4f
spent
true